Transaction 39b5bdac777abf7d4d89ea278db39048f99e5e991cf806a2aee7ea55f0541088

100 Input
1 Outputs
  • 39b5bdac777abf7d4d89ea278db39048f99e5e991cf806a2aee7ea55f0541088:0
  • value  267515431
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h